# Break-Glass Access — LintLedger Plugin Registry

Plugin authors: normal publishing goes through the standard review pipeline. Break-glass is for one case only — a broken lint rule blocking every downstream build. Request emergency access from the Fennmark maintainers, state the affected rule ID, and wait for two approvals. Once granted, the emergency console unlocks for 30 minutes. To authenticate at the console, you will be asked for the recovery passphrase:

recovery phrase for fajeg-hagug: holox-fenmir

### Changelog — Ferrowick Export Service v2.4.1

Heads up: failed exports now retry automatically! Previously, if an export job died mid-run (usually a flaky storage timeout), you had to requeue it by hand. Now the service retries up to three times with exponential backoff, and only surfaces an error after the final attempt. Partial files are cleaned up between attempts, so no more duplicate rows. If you hit anything weird with the new retry logic, the feature is owned by the person named below.

named custodian: Oliath Ralax

The ingest job (maintained by the Harrowgate team) polls the drop every fifteen minutes and moves files into the staging bucket after checksum validation. Failed files land in a quarantine folder and page whoever is on rotation. Credentials rotate quarterly; the rotation procedure is automated but needs a manual sign-off. Setup steps, folder conventions, and the quarantine recovery process are all documented at the internal page below.

operations page: https://jira.qorvelsys.internal/browse/pages/browse/pages

Subject: Handoff on the Pixelbin leak

Hey all, quick note before the sync: the memory leak in the Pixelbin image cache is still chewing through heap on the render nodes. I'm rotating off to the Glimmer migration, so this is changing hands. Questions about the leak investigation should now go to the new owner below.

named custodian: Brivan Eliath Quenox Frador